The financial structure of Five Guys further complicates the narrative of its net worth, as it exists as a privately held company, shielded from the quarterly earnings pressures of the public market. This status means that precise figures regarding revenue and profit are estimates, derived from industry analyses, franchise disclosures, and general market trends, rather than officially audited statements. The company operates under a franchise model, but with a notable twist: prospective franchisees are reportedly required to have a net worth of at least $300,000 and possess $100,000 in liquid assets. This stringent requirement acts as a powerful filtering mechanism, ensuring that franchise partners are financially stable and deeply committed to the brand. The revenue stream for the parent entity is primarily derived from initial franchise fees, ongoing royalty payments based on gross sales, and contributions for advertising. As of recent estimates, the company has expanded to over 1,500 locations globally, a figure that represents a substantial scaling of the original vision. Each new franchise location contributes to the overall ecosystem, generating recurring revenue streams that collectively bolster the estimated net worth of the organization, placing it firmly in the upper echelons of the quick-service restaurant industry.

Beyond the glitz of the silver screen, De Niro has shown the same dedication to business that he does to his craft. He has made significant investments in the real estate market, most notably the extensive Tribeca portfolio. His acquisition and renovation of townhouses, commercial spaces, and the renowned Greenwich Hotel in lower Manhattan represent a substantial and tangible asset base. These properties are not merely residences but lucrative hospitality and lifestyle ventures. Additionally, he has ventured into the restaurant business, with establishments like Nobu, although his involvement has varied over the years, these ventures contribute to the cash flow that supports his overall net worth. Unlike many celebrities who spend lavishly, De Niro has largely maintained a lifestyle that, while comfortable, does not involve the kind of profligate spending that erodes wealth. He has channeled his resources into preserving his legacy and securing the financial future of his family.
